Ep 2: Casting Shade: Shade Inequity, Health, and Spatial Justice
Episode 2
Monday, 20 July, 2020

Summer is the best season in Rhode Island. People are outside all the time and cooling off under the shade of big, lush trees. What happens when you don’t have shade to cool off in? Some neighborhoods have little to no shade, and usually have higher concentrations of Black folx. Why do urban heat maps and redlining maps align? How can we consider shade a resource like food & housing? How do COVID & the climate crisis widen these inequities?
